Finance Review — Hallowick Reseller Programme

Summary for sales leads: reseller revenue grew 14% this half, led by the Brenmoor tier. Rebate costs ran slightly over budget, mainly from the volume-bonus structure introduced in spring. Partner churn stayed low. Finance recommends tightening rebate eligibility and consolidating the two lowest tiers. Detailed ledgers are available on request. The confidential note on next year's programme direction is appended below.

internal memo for kawip-hadug: Headcount on the Wenwyn team goes from 7 to 140 by the end of January. Gross margin on Wenwyn came in at 20 percent against a plan of 15 percent.

Handover note — Crumbwheel order cutoffs.

Welcome aboard. The bakery cutoff rule in Crumbwheel closes same-day orders at 14:00 local to each storefront, not UTC — this has bitten us twice. Holiday overrides live in the calendar service and take precedence silently, so always check there first when a cutoff looks wrong. To unlock the calendar service's admin console after a restart, enter the recovery passphrase below.

vault phrase of bagap-bahaf = silion-pelox-sorox-casdor-quenwyn-fraax-eliox-praael-kelion-quenvan-kasox-rusael-norius-belvan

Handover — Thursday. Reception desk moves to the ground floor Friday morning. Movers arrive 07:00; phones switch over by 09:00. Old mezzanine desk stays live until noon, then decommissioned. Visitor badges, logbook, and the courier stamp are already boxed — box marked REC-1. Deliveries redirect to the new desk automatically. Nothing else changes on the rota. The ground-floor stationery cupboard behind the new desk is keypad-locked; the code is:

door code, yagap-bahof: bdg-O-05